Flood Advisory for Dallas and Perry Counties Until 3:30 am
The National Weather Service in Birmingham has issued a
* Urban and Small Stream Flood Advisory for…
Perry County in central Alabama…
Dallas County in south central Alabama…
* Until 330 AM CDT.
* At 1222 AM CDT, Doppler radar indicated heavy rain. This will
cause urban and small stream flooding. Between 2 and 3 inches of
rain have fallen.
Some locations that will experience flooding include…
Selma, Valley Grande, Marion, Uniontown, Selmont-West Selmont,
Orrville, Newbern, Potter Station, Dallas County Horse Arena,
Marion Junction, Bogue Chitto, Memorial Stadium, Old Cahaba Park,
Vaiden, Paul M Grist State Park, Dallas Lake, Burnsville, Dannelly
Reservoir, Belknap and Central Mills.
Additional rainfall of 1 to 2 inches is expected over the area. This
additional rain will result in minor flooding.
P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S…
Turn around, don’t dr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ood
deaths occur in vehicles.
Be especially cautious at night when it is harder to recognize the
dangers of flooding.
